25 / 32 page ![]() Coil thermal protection Maximizing the power transfer is often desirable, but not always possible in all operating conditions: applications in which the wireless power receiver has poor power dissipation capability and/or the power loss in the receiving coil is relevant (e.g. very tiny and slim coils with relatively high DC-resistance) may require some thermal protection. This feature is easily implemented with STWLC68 thanks to its NTC pin. A channel of the internal ADC is routed to the NTC pin, allowing the user to read the voltage across an external NTC thermistor. Figure 15. External NTC thermistor connection Defining a protection threshold is clearly possible by setting the internal registers of STWLC68. The voltage at the NTC pin is sampled, converted and compared to the threshold every millisecond: if an over-temperature occurs and the corresponding interrupt is enabled, the INT pin goes low. Additionally, one of the following actions (or both) may take place according to the selected option. 1. Main LDO linear regulator output disconnection; 2. End-of-Power-Transfer packet transmission The value of the NTC thermistor and the high-side resistor (R6 in Figure 15) are not critical. An example for R6 and R7 is shown in Table 7: with these parts the 0.6 V threshold at the NTC pin is crossed at about 65°C. 6.3 PCB routing guidelines 1. Auxiliary 1V8 and 5V0 LDO filtering capacitors should be placed as close as possible to the STWLC68. Connection traces should be short and placed in top layer. Capacitors ground can be connected directly into GND plane. 2. CRECT and COUT capacitors should be placed close to STWLC68 with higher priority than RCL resistor 3. Power traces (AC1, AC2, VRECT, VOUT) should be kept wide enough to sustain high current. Duplicating these traces in inner layers is advisable wherever possible. 4. AC1 and AC2 tracks should be routed closely to minimize the area of the resulting loop antenna. 5. Thermal performance and grounding should be always optimized by preserving bottom layer (usually assigned to ground) integrity. 6.4 References 1.
